Gas station rooftop panels smash up 2 cars in Mississauga

Strong winds may have sent rooftop panels crashing down on two cars at a gas station at Winston Churchill Boulevard and Argentia Road in Mississauga late Monday morning. Luckily no one was injured.

 

Top Stories

Top Stories

Most Watched Today